desert pocket mouse vs Linnaeus's mouse opossum
Chaetodipus penicillatus compared with Marmosa murina
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| desert pocket mouse | Linnaeus's mouse opossum |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class same | Mammalia (Mammals)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Rodentia (Rodents) | Didelphimorphia (Didelphimorphia) |
| Family | Heteromyidae | Didelphidae |
| Genus | Chaetodipus | Marmosa |
| Species | Chaetodipus penicillatus | Marmosa murina |
Evolutionary Relationship
desert pocket mouse and Linnaeus's mouse opossum share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(Mammals)
